Common Causes of Uber Accidents in Colleyville
Aside from the recovery process, Uber accidents are much like any other car accident. They can be caused by numerous factors that result from another driver’s negligence. Injuries and damage can range from minor to catastrophic and have considerable repercussions.
Some common causes of car accidents in Colleyville can include:
- Distractions
- Alcohol and drug impairment
- Speeding
- Reckless and aggressive driving
- Bad weather and road conditions
- Failure to yield or stop
- Nighttime driving
- Improper turns
- Tire blowouts
- Inexperience
- Animals
These factors can cause serious injuries, and all parties involved should receive medical attention after an accident.
Some injuries may not be apparent immediately or visible without medical tests, so you should never assume you are okay based solely on outward appearances. A medical professional will be able to walk you through the scope of your injuries and their proposed treatment plan.
A Colleyville Uber Accident Attorney Will Establish the Negligent Party’s Liability in Your Case
Many Uber accidents are preventable, and the person responsible can be held liable for negligence. Personal injury cases are built upon this premise, and it must be established as fact through evidence in your case. Your Colleyville car accident lawyer will demonstrate four key elements to establish that the other party was at fault for your losses, which include:
- Duty: The other party had a responsibility to uphold the rules of the road and use the utmost caution to ensure safety while driving.
- Breach: When the other party took part in unsafe activities, they breached their duty, which in turn put others at risk.
- Causation: The other party’s actions were directly tied to the accident that caused you harm and impacted your life.
- Damages: The negligent party is responsible for compensating you for the losses you suffered at their hands.

Your Claim Process is Dependent on the Status of the Uber Driver
While many aspects of an Uber accident mirror a normal car accident, the claim process is where it diverges. Who you file your claim against will depend on the driver’s status at the time of the collision. Although insurance for rideshare and delivery drivers is required, different insurance policies cover different stages. There are three different types of insurance you could potentially file your claim with:
- The driver’s insurance: If an Uber driver causes an accident while they are not actively signed in and driving, then their personal auto insurance will cover your damages.
- Third-party insurance: This type of insurance is used when the driver is online and waiting for a ride request. In this case, a third-party liability insurance will pay for the damage up to $50,000 per person and $100,000 per accident. It will also cover up to $25,000 of property damage.
- Uber’s insurance: When accidents happen during a ride or on the way to pick up a passenger, a claim can be filed with Uber itself. They provide up to $1,000,000 in insurance coverage.
Regardless of what type of claim you file, you should report the accident to Uber within the app. They will provide a form where you can provide all relevant information about the accident. An Uber representative will follow up with questions and directions on how to move forward with your claim.
